Transaction 56c66f4a47f04160cb675809f5ef2666b3d64efb6e171160f749128629a75c5f

1 Input
2 Outputs
  • 56c66f4a47f04160cb675809f5ef2666b3d64efb6e171160f749128629a75c5f:0
  • value  34214118
    address  17rjgAfit7sjzyR5u7PSC3DkyNkWEAAXRy
  • 56c66f4a47f04160cb675809f5ef2666b3d64efb6e171160f749128629a75c5f:1
  • value  1932000
    address  1DzssmaCA7KLAczxU83228NoatCw4kY43k